The Role of Hormones
Overexercise triggers an increase in stress hormones such as cortisol and adrenaline. Elevated cortisol levels late in the day can interfere with the body’s ability to relax and transition into sleep. Additionally, excessive activity can alter melatonin production, the hormone responsible for regulating sleep-wake cycles. Disruptions in these hormones can make it harder to fall asleep and maintain restful sleep throughout the night.
Nervous System Overactivation
Engaging in very intense workouts or long training sessions can overstimulate the sympathetic nervous system, which is responsible for the fight or flight response. Overactivation of this system keeps the body in a heightened state of alertness, increasing heart rate and blood pressure, which can directly contribute to insomnia. Proper recovery and parasympathetic activation, which promotes relaxation, are crucial to prevent this effect.

Timing and Intensity of Exercise
The timing and type of exercise are critical factors in whether physical activity will improve or disrupt sleep. For instance
Late-Night High-Intensity Workouts
Engaging in vigorous exercise late in the evening can stimulate the nervous system and raise core body temperature, both of which interfere with falling asleep. High-intensity interval training (HIIT) or heavy weightlifting within a few hours of bedtime can make it difficult for the body to enter a relaxed state conducive to sleep.
Morning or Afternoon Exercise
Exercise earlier in the day generally promotes better sleep by aligning with circadian rhythms. Moderate-intensity cardio or strength training in the morning or early afternoon allows sufficient time for hormone levels to normalize and the body to cool down before bedtime.
Overtraining Syndrome and Sleep Disruption
Overexercise can lead to overtraining syndrome (OTS), a condition seen in athletes and fitness enthusiasts who train excessively without adequate rest. OTS affects both physical performance and sleep patterns. Individuals with OTS often report insomnia, increased sleep fragmentation, and reduced sleep quality. Chronic overtraining can also lead to fatigue, hormonal imbalances, and weakened immunity, all of which contribute to further sleep disturbances.
Physical and Psychological Impact
Overtraining affects the body and mind in multiple ways
- Persistent muscle soreness and joint pain that disrupts sleep comfort
- Elevated stress hormones that interfere with relaxation
- Increased anxiety or irritability, which can exacerbate insomnia
- Decreased production of restorative growth hormones during deep sleep
Addressing overtraining is essential to restore normal sleep patterns and prevent long-term health consequences.
Strategies to Prevent Insomnia from Overexercise
Proper management of exercise routines can help prevent sleep disturbances associated with overexercise. Key strategies include
- Moderate exercise intensity Avoid excessively long or high-intensity workouts, especially in the evening.
- Timing workouts strategically Aim to finish vigorous exercise at least three to four hours before bedtime.
- Prioritize recovery Incorporate rest days, stretching, yoga, or light walks to support muscle recovery and nervous system balance.
- Hydration and nutrition Proper hydration and balanced meals help prevent stress on the body that can exacerbate sleep issues.
- Sleep hygiene Maintain a consistent sleep schedule, create a comfortable sleep environment, and limit screen time before bed.
